Understanding Decentralization: Cognizance of its Tenets and Benefits

Decentralization plays a pivotal role in the cryptocurrency ecosystem, representing a paradigm shift from centralized architectures. In decentralized systems, control and decision-making are distributed across a network of nodes, eliminating the reliance on a singular authority. This fundamental tenet fosters several advantages:

  • Enhanced Security: By eliminating central points of failure, decentralized systems become less susceptible to malicious attacks and unauthorized access. Hackers are unable to compromise the entire network by targeting a single entity.
  • Increased Transparency: Decentralized ledger technologies, such as blockchain, provide an immutable and transparent record of transactions. All participants have access to the same data, promoting accountability and trust.
  • Empowerment of Users: Decentralization empowers users by giving them control over their own assets and data. They are not reliant on external entities to manage their finances or safeguard their information.

Roadblocks to Decentralization Adoption: Obstacles Hindering its Widespread Usage

Despite its inherent advantages, decentralization faces certain challenges that impede its widespread adoption:

  • Scalability Concerns: Decentralized networks can be inherently slower and less scalable than centralized systems due to the need for consensus among multiple nodes. This limitation can hinder the efficient processing of large volumes of transactions.
  • Complexity: Decentralized systems can be complex to understand and implement, requiring a higher level of technical expertise. This poses a barrier for users who may not possess the necessary knowledge or resources.
  • Dependency on Stable Nodes: Decentralized networks rely on a sufficient number of stable and reliable nodes to maintain their integrity. Nodes can become compromised or fail, potentially leading to network instability or data loss.

The Spectrum of Decentralized Usage: Assessing Levels of Adoption

Users exhibit varying levels of decentralization adoption, ranging from full adherence to partial or limited usage:

  • Full Decentralization: This represents the complete adoption of decentralized principles, where users have full control over their assets and data. They exclusively interact with decentralized protocols and applications.
  • Partial Decentralization: Users in this category leverage decentralized services for specific aspects of their crypto activities, such as storing their assets in decentralized wallets or utilizing decentralized exchanges. However, they may still rely on centralized platforms for certain functions.
  • Limited Decentralization: Users who fall under this category primarily engage with centralized exchanges and services, limiting their exposure to decentralization. They may possess a basic understanding of decentralized concepts but do not actively participate in decentralized networks.

Potential Drawbacks: Navigating the Challenges of Decentralization

While decentralization offers numerous benefits, it is not without potential drawbacks:

  • Increased Responsibility: Decentralized systems shift the responsibility of asset management and security onto individual users. This requires a high level of vigilance and expertise, as there is no central authority to provide support or recourse in case of losses.
  • Potential Complexity: Decentralized applications can be more complex to navigate compared to centralized counterparts. Users may encounter technical challenges or require a deeper understanding of blockchain technology to fully utilize these platforms.
  • Lack of Regulations: The decentralized nature of cryptocurrencies and blockchain technology often operates outside of traditional regulatory frameworks. This can lead to uncertainty and potential risks for users.

Embracing Decentralization: Maximizing its Potential for Enhanced Security and Autonomy

Harnessing the full potential of decentralization requires a concerted effort to address the challenges and optimize its benefits:

  • Education and Awareness: Promoting education and raising awareness about decentralization can empower users with the knowledge and skills to navigate decentralized networks securely and effectively.
  • Simplifying User Interfaces: Decentralized applications must strive to provide user-friendly interfaces that simplify interactions and reduce complexity. By making decentralized platforms more accessible, adoption can be encouraged.
  • Collaboration and Innovation: Collaboration among developers, researchers, and users is essential to drive innovation and overcome technical challenges. By pooling resources and expertise, the limitations of decentralization can be minimized.
